The vendor is required to provide to obtain a cloud-based solution (“solution”) to track compliance relating to minority business (“MBE”) participation goals and prevailing wage contract requirements for some of authority and authority -managed contracts.
- The solution shall have the following capabilities:
• Be a stand-alone web-based solution.
• Currently, authority does not intend for this solution to interface with any of its current systems;
• The solution shall be operational (i.e., not under development) and generally available by the due date of the proposal with minimum initial set-up requirements;
• Be able to track all types of contracts, including construction and related professional service contracts (such as architectural, engineering, consulting, etc.).
• Be capable of creating “departments”, “units”, or “programs” within authority and have the data capable of being tracked and reported on separately.
• This capability should not be restricted to particular data points, and need to be able to be aggregated across all departments.
• All subcontractor payments shall be capable of being reported and verified electronically, including whether payment was made promptly. preferably, the system will contain the ability to notify the subcontractor via email at the time of input by prime;
• Track actual MBE participation against MBE participation goals and subgoals and by MDOT minority and woman categories with no limit on tiers;
• Capability to identify an individual and modify administrative rights for all users to ensure proper access and confidentiality;
• Generate correspondence (emails, letters, etc.) to contractors and authority representatives that can be issued directly from the system and have an ability to track and retain such correspondence.
• The correspondence capability should also include notification, routing, and automated alerts from the system, via email, to the selected authority representative when correspondence or other documentation/information is uploaded or input into the system;
• Track vendors (both prime and subs) for all applicable projects.
• For prevailing wage requirements, provide an ability to track each vendor, prime contractor, or subcontractor’s total number of employees, and whether those employees are residents of targeted zip codes and municipal overlaps;
• Ability to apply workforce utilization data and generate internal reports to include certified payroll input.
• This should include reporting and tracking residency and hiring efforts;
• Ability to add/track vendors based on certification status, NAICS code and location.
• Ability to modify access rights and other administrative rights within the software;
• Must have reliable back-up systems and industry-standard security protocols;
• Data, databases, and derived data products created, collected, manipulated, or directly purchased as part of an RFP will become the property of the authority.
• The authority will be considered the custodian of the data and shall determine the use, access, and distribution;
• Data and reports must be able to be exported to excel;
• Must accommodate an unlimited number of users;
• Must accept data entry from multiple users simultaneously;
• Must provide training and software support team services that include implementation, configuration, system usage, data management, technical, security, and user reporting.
